The ODU Libraries welcome distance students to use our services and resources! We are here to help you succeed in your coursework and research. This guide will show you how to access and request materials and how to get help with your research. See the rest of our Library Guides for subject specific help and more!
Our Library Chat or Ask A Librarian are great ways to get quick help from librarians and staff in the ODU Libraries! You can access chat on almost every page on our website, including this page. For Ask A Librarian, simply fill out the form linked below and we will respond within 24 hours.
Watch this one-minute video to learn more about our Help Service!
If you need more in-depth help than an email or chat will allow, you can schedule an online appointment with a librarian. An appointment can range from a brief 15 minute session to a full hour. There is a librarian for every area of study at ODU as well as for our general education courses. Click on the link below to schedule an appointment!
